ENDIGO ATHLETIC SPORTS AND HORSE-RACINa, TO BE HELD AT • .WAKEFIELD, .DECEMBER 31st and JANUARY Ist. Stewards: Messrs J. Williams, J. Stewart, E. Sams, Wm. Cameron, and E. Rigg. Judoe : Mr J. Dewar. Starter : Mr John Wrightson. PROGRAMME. FIRST DAY. Quoit Match, 18 yds.—First prize, £1 10s ; second, 15s ; third, ss. Maiden- Plate, for all horses that have never won an advertised race of the value of £s.—Prize, £5. Punning High Leap.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. 100 yds Foot Race (handicap).—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. Cumberland Wrestling.—First prize, £2 ; second, 203 ; third, 10s. Sack Race.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. Bop, Step, and prize, 20s ; second,. 10s; third, ss. 200 yds Foot Race (handicap).—First prize, 30s ; second, 15s ; third, 7s Gd. . Putting the Stone.—First prize, 20s; second, 10s ; third, ss. Standing High Jump.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. District Handicap Horse Race, for all horses owned in the Bendigo District for one month previous to the race.— Prize, £7. 100 yds Three-legged Race.—First prize, 30s; second, 15s ; third, 10s. Standing Flat Jump.—First prize, 20s; second, 10s ; third, ss. SECOND DAY. Quoit Match, 21yds.—First prize, 30s ; second, 15s ; third, ss. Trotting Match (handicap), no weight under list.—Prize, £5. Vaulting with the Pole.—First prize, 30s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. Bendigo Handicap Foot Race; three events ; to be decided by points ; first event, 150yds.—First prize, £5; second, £2 ; third, £l. Cornish Wrestling.—First prize, £2 ; second, 20s ; third, 10s. Throwing the Hammer.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. Three Standing Jumps.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ss, Bendigo Handicap Foot Race; second event, 300 yds. Collar and Elbow Wrestling.—First prize, £2 ; second, 20s ; third, 10s. Sack Race.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. Bendigo Handicap Foot Race ; third event, 440 yds. Bendigo Handicap Horse Race.—£ls. Consolation Foot Race.—First prize, 20s ; second, 10s ; third, ss. 10s entry for each of the Horse Races. Anyone entering a horse for the Bendigo Handicap must be a subscriber to the race fund of £l. All other events, entry Is. The decision of the Stewards to be final in all cases. Re Samuel Thomas, Deceased Intestate. fc LL Persons having claims ngainst the L Estate of the above-named Deceased are requested to forward the same to A. Bathgate, Esq., Dunedin, onorbtfore WEDNESDAY, the 29th day of December next. J. WOODWARD, Public Trustee. Wellington,' Dec. 6, 1575. ARDER OF JUDGE. In the Supreme Court of New Zealand, Wellington District: this sixth day of December, 1b75. Upon reading the affidavits of Jonas Woodward, of Wellington, Public Trustee, and of Thomas M'Gann, of Cromwell, Senior-constable, 1 do order that the Public Trustee) the Curator of the Estates of Deceased Persons, shall be Administrator of all and singular the goods, chattels, and credits of SAMUEL THOMAS, Deceased, and that this Order be published in the Cromwell Argus newspaper. (Signed) JAMES PRENDEKGAST, C.J. -j\IVE POUNDS REWARD. STRAYED FROM CROMWELL, A Bay Mare branded G on near shoulder, and a Bay Horse branded S on the off shoulder. Whoever will bring the same to JAS.
